 Candy Bar & Pretzel Brownies 

Yields: 12 brownies

Ingredients: 

  • 1 Box of your favorite brownie mix, this time I used Pillsbury
  • Ingredients called for in mix
  • 1/4 cup crunched up pretzels, I used square snaps
  • Assorted chocolate candy, I used Hugs, Rolos, M&Ms, Snickers, Three Musketeers, cut into small pieces. Semisweet and milk chocolate chips

Directions:

  1. Preheat oven to package directions, spray desired sized pan with cooking spray. Set aside.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ine ingredients from package of brownie mix. Make sure you get all the dry incorporated well into the wet ingredients.
  3. Pour batter into prepared pan.
  4. Toss candy over batter and gently press down into batter. Add crunched up pretzels then chocolate chips. You can always add some more candy on top.
  5. Bake as per package directions.
  6. Cool completely for easy cutting.
  7. Can be stored in a sealed container on counter up to 3 days.
